CVE-2026-43284 / "Dirty Frag" .. Antoher one of those nasty local-privilege-escallations. Quickfix for Centos/Fedora based systems: printf 'install esp4 /bin/false\ninstall esp6 /bin/false\ninstall rxrpc /bin/false\n' > /etc/modprobe.d/dirtyfrag.conf && rmmod esp4 esp6 rxrpc 2>/dev/null; true Caution: That also effectively disables IPSEC and AFS client support. But it can easily be reverted by removing the file when a patched kernel arrives. #dirtyfrag #cve_2026_43284 #security #centos #fedora #redhat

Let's Encrypt just stopped the issuance of certificates after an "incident": https://letsencrypt.status.io/pages/incident/55957a99e800baa4470002da/69fe2d6698ca07050eb4b1b3 If anyone encounters issues today with failed certificate renewals: It's probably not your setup. #letsencrypt #itsec #devops #linux #security #tls
